The Connection Between Gambling and Mental Health

The link between gambling and mental health is complex and multifaceted. Many individuals engage in gambling as a form of entertainment, but this recreational activity can rapidly escalate into problematic behavior. The thrill of winning can release d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ure, thereby increasing the appeal of gambling. However, this same pleasure-seeking behavior can lead to addiction, resulting in detrimental mental health consequences such as anxiety and depression. Furthermore, the psychological impact of gambling addiction can create a vicious cycle. Individuals may gamble to escape from their problems or to seek relief from emotional distress. This temporary escape, however, often leads to greater financial strain, which compounds stress and mental health issues. As they lose more money, the anxiety intensifies, resulting in feelings of guilt, shame, and hopelessness, thus worsening the mental health condition.

It is vital to recognize these hidden effects on mental health to provide adequate support and resources for those in need. By understanding the psychological dynamics behind gambling behavior, friends, family, and mental health professionals can better address the challenges faced by individuals affected by gambling. Awareness and education about these connections are key to reducing stigma and encouraging individuals to seek help.

The Role of Financial Stress

Financial stress is one of the most significant hidden effects of gambling on mental health. When individuals engage in gambling, they often underestimate the potential financial consequences. The initial thrill of winning can lead to poor decision-making, encouraging further risky behavior. This can result in substantial debt, which places overwhelming pressure on both the gambler and their loved ones.

The burden of financial instability can manifest in various mental health issues, including anxiety, depression, and increased irritability. As financial obligations grow, so does the despair associated with potentially losing everything. This state of chronic stress can trigger serious conditions like panic attacks, leading to a decline in overall well-being. The long-term effects of these financial challenges often create a spiraling effect that becomes increasingly difficult to escape.

Support systems are crucial during these times, as individuals may feel isolated and ashamed of their gambling habits. Counseling, therapy, and support groups can play a significant role in addressing financial stress linked to gambling. By recognizing that financial strain is a common consequence of gambling, individuals can better navigate their challenges and begin the journey toward recovery and improved mental health.

The Impact on Relationships

The effects of gambling extend beyond the individual, significantly impacting relationships with family and friends. When gambling becomes problematic, it often leads to a breakdown in trust and communication. Loved ones may feel betrayed by the gambler’s secrecy or lies about their gambling habits, which can create a rift in relationships. This emotional distance can lead to feelings of resentment, anger, and abandonment.

Moreover, the financial implications of gambling can strain relationships to the breaking point. Families may find themselves in crisis situations due to lost income or savings, leading to arguments and conflict. Children in these environments may experience emotional distress, as they witness their parents struggling with addiction, further complicating familial bonds. The sense of instability and unpredictability can create a toxic environment that harms the mental health of all involved.

Rebuilding trust after gambling-related conflicts requires open communication and a commitment to change. Couples and families must work together to establish boundaries and seek professional help to address the underlying issues contributing to gambling behavior. By focusing on rebuilding relationships and supporting one another, families can navigate the turbulent waters of gambling addiction and work toward healthier dynamics.

The Importance of Early Intervention

Recognizing the early signs of gambling-related mental health issues is crucial in mitigating long-term consequences. Early intervention can lead to more effective treatment outcomes, allowing individuals to regain control over their behavior before it spirals out of hand. Common signs of problematic gambling include emotional distress, social withdrawal, and increased secrecy about financial matters.

Many individuals may not seek help until their gambling has resulted in severe mental health repercussions. Thus, it is vital for friends, family, and healthcare providers to be vigilant in identifying these signs and encouraging open dialogues about gambling habits. Educational programs focusing on responsible gambling practices can empower individuals to make informed decisions and reduce the stigma surrounding seeking help.

Various treatment options are available for those struggling with gambling addiction, including counseling, behavioral therapy, and support groups. These interventions can provide individuals with coping strategies to manage their urges and confront underlying mental health issues. By emphasizing early intervention, we can foster a culture of understanding and support, enabling individuals to reclaim their lives and improve their mental well-being.
